Hello, Do you really need the original remote? It will probaly cost a fortune and be hard to get. I would suggest buying a decent Universal Remote. I prefer the ones with the learning feature in case you want to customize it but most of them will control all the feautures of your remote (is that the model which is like a flip phone?). You can buy them at any store (Walmart, Circuit City) and they cost $15 to $25 without getting fancy. I like to find a Best Buy which has been returned for some reason because they usually mark them down 50%. You can even buy Sony if you are concerned it won't control everything or want the brands to match (but I like the ergonomics of the Philips).
